Paperclip — AI Agent Teams as Companies

About Paperclip

Open-source framework for building AI agent teams organized as virtual companies — CEO, Engineer, and QA agents coordinate work through projects, issues, and heartbeat schedules.

Key Capabilities

Agent teams structured as companies with CEO, Engineer, and QA roles

16 pre-built importable company templates to start immediately

React dashboard at localhost:3100 for monitoring and controlling agents

Embedded Postgres — no external database setup required

Heartbeat scheduling for background autonomous work runs

claude_local adapter for using Claude as your agent model

Standout Features

Company Metaphor

Agents organized as company roles — CEO delegates, Engineers execute, QA reviews — mirroring a real software team structure.

React Dashboard

Monitor active agents, projects, and issues from a local web interface at localhost:3100. No CLI required for day-to-day oversight.

Heartbeat Scheduling

Agents run on configurable schedules — set them going overnight and check results in the morning. Budget tracking keeps costs visible.
